Program delivery update: Post-graduation work permit length for 2 combined programs

This section contains policy, procedures and guidance used by IRCC staff. It is posted on the department’s website as a courtesy to stakeholders.

April 5, 2019

The instructions have been updated to clarify the validity for a post-graduate work permit issued to a student who completed more than one program at an eligible institution within 2 years.

Previous text

If the combined length is more than 2 years (or 1,800 hours for diploma of vocational studies [DVS] and attestation of vocational specialization [AVS] programs in Quebec), the work permit may be valid for up to 3 years.

New text

If the combined length of the programs is 2 years or longer (or 1,800 hours or longer for DVS and AVS programs in Quebec), the work permit may be valid for up to 3 years.
